In celebration of 30 years of Pokémon this month, Mathieu Mistler created a fan art of his first-ever starter Pokémon, Treecko, based on an illustration by Mei Ford. As the artist shared, "This one was fun to do but also challenging," as he pushed his hand-painting skills to adapt the complex details of the original artwork, especially the tree:
